Webfrom the table above the maximum moisture content in air at 20oC is 17.3 g/m3, and. the maximum moisture content in air with temperature 50oC is 83 g/m3. The increased ability to carry moisture can be calculated as. 100 % ( (83 g/m3) - (17.3 g/m3)) / (17.3 g/m3) = 380 %. This dramatic change is important to explain why heated air is so much ...

WebJan 18, 2024 · A oft-repeated water vapor myth is that warm air can “hold” more water vapor than cool air because as the air warms its molecules move farther apart, making room for more molecules. This leads to the idea that as air cools its molecules move closer together, “squeezing” out water vapor.
